Transaction 73d60a311135b89b1cb7175f232b014bdcebbb4094f7c47150fe4ebe53c84f53
2 Input
2 Outputs
- 73d60a311135b89b1cb7175f232b014bdcebbb4094f7c47150fe4ebe53c84f53:0
- 73d60a311135b89b1cb7175f232b014bdcebbb4094f7c47150fe4ebe53c84f53:1
value 210000
address 1EfduJAXbBE5NsAZ7ppSLQSxFCpryAkfky
value 26782473
address 18HcxSn2YsNgJGsE6QR6986CR8yskQ6a7m